What Are the Benefits of Protein?

Protein intake can vary depending on your caloric needs, which are influenced by your age, size, fitness level, and other factors.

Protein has been shown to help with weight loss and weight management.

 Because it makes you feel full for longer.

One study found that when overweight women increased their protein intake from 15 percent to 30 percent, they ate about 400 fewer calories a day.

Research also shows that eating more protein helps you maintain muscle mass and build muscles and strength during strength training.

Protein has potential metabolism-boosting effects.

It could also help lower your blood pressure and promotes bone health.
